Solvative is a company that specializes in designing and developing user-centered digital solutions. They focus on user experience and interface design, web and mobile application development, and digital transformation. Solvative takes a human-centric approach to technology, ensuring solutions are tailored to the real-life needs of users and businesses. They utilize various technologies, including AWS, Oracle Cloud, and AR/VR for e-commerce, to advance businesses and improve customer engagement. Their methodology, known as 'Solve Forward,' aims to future-proof businesses by addressing current needs while preparing for upcoming challenges.

📋 Description

• Lead end-to-end project management for software development and technology initiatives. • Define project scope, objectives, timelines, deliverables, and resource requirements. • Collaborate with product managers, engineers, designers, QA, and stakeholders. • Manage project plans, schedules, risks, dependencies, and budgets. • Facilitate Agile ceremonies: sprint planning, stand-ups, reviews, and retrospectives. • Track progress and provide clear, regular status updates to stakeholders and leadership. • Identify and proactively mitigate project risks and issues. • Coordinate across cross-functional teams to resolve technical and operational challenges. • Drive process improvements and best practices in delivery. • Manage stakeholder expectations and maintain clear communication across the project lifecycle.

🎯 Requirements

•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, IT, Engineering, or a related field. • 5+ years in project management, with at least 3 years managing software development projects. • Strong understanding of the software development life cycle (SDLC). • Experience managing web, mobile, cloud, or enterprise application projects. • Proven experience with Agile, Scrum, or Kanban. • Strong command of tools such as Jira, Confluence, or Azure DevOps. • Excellent stakeholder management, communication, and leadership skills. • Ability to manage multiple projects and priorities simultaneously.

🏖️ Benefits

• MacBooks for all team members. • Sponsored certifications and paid learning programs. • Flexible working hours supporting work-life balance. • A supportive and collaborative team culture. • Option for remote working, with office visits as required. • Travel & accommodation reimbursements for required office visits.
